Software Reinstall (Li-Ion Battery)
CAUTION:
Vehicle software version 2023.12 or newer is required in order to perform this procedure.
- Connect the LV maintainer to the vehicle, but do not disconnect the LV battery. See LV Maintainer (Connect and Disconnect)
.NOTE: It is OK for the LV maintainer and LV battery to both be connected while performing this procedure.
- Connect a laptop with Toolbox 3 to the vehicle. See Toolbox 3 (Connect and Disconnect) NOTE: Locally connecting the vehicle to Toolbox 3 will automatically enable Service Mode Plus.
- In Toolbox, select the Actions/Autodiag tab, and then search for "redeploy".
- Run the appropriate routine and wait for the reinstallation to complete. Reinstallation status can be monitored on the vehicle touchscreen.
- Service CAN Redeploy (UPDATE_CAN-REDEPLOY) - A "partial" software reinstallation that reinstalls the currently installed software package to all module, ECU, and component replacements, with the exception of the car computer.
- Service Redeploy (UPDATE_SERVICE-REDEPLOY) - A "full" software reinstallation that reinstalls the currently installed software package to the car computer, and all module, ECU, and component replacements.
- Once the reinstallation is complete, check that the release notes appear on the touchscreen, indicating a successful reinstallation.
- Disconnect the LV maintainer from the vehicle. See LV Maintainer (Connect and Disconnect) .
- Disconnect the laptop from the vehicle. See Toolbox 3 (Connect and Disconnect)
- Disable Service Mode. See SERVICE MODE .
- Install the rear underhood apron. See UNDERHOOD APRON - REAR (REMOVE AND REPLACE) .
